移动通讯系统中计费网关多重重定向实现方法及其装置的制作方法

文档序号:7624513阅读:139来源:国知局
专利名称:移动通讯系统中计费网关多重重定向实现方法及其装置的制作方法
技术领域
本发明涉及移动通讯系统中无线业务的计费网关多重重定向实现方法及其装置。
在WCDMA计费协议(3GPP TS 32.015)中规定为尽量避免话单丢失,协议要求话单不能保存在GSN中太长时间(保存时间越长,越容易受异常情况的影响而导致话单丢失,比如断电),应尽快发送给CG,所以当GSN和某一CG通讯中断后,将原本准备发往此CG的话单,全部转发给其他CG。
因此引入了CG重定向功能CG1故障后,将剩余“未发送”或“发送但未得到确认”的话单,发送给CG2,由于只重定向了一次,所以称作单重重定向。
参见

图1~图3。单重重定向有以下两种情况一种如图1、图2所示,其方法是1、当GSN向CG1发送话单后,未收到响应前,通讯中断,则GSN将此话单转而发送给CG2,消息类型为“可能重复的话单”,此时CG2将此话单保存,不立即发送给BS;2、当CG1通讯恢复正常后,GSN向CG1发送“测试空帧”,询问CG1在通讯中断前是否已经收到话单,CG1回复“未收到”;3、GSN向CG2发送“释放话单消息”,通知CG2将此话单释放给BS。
另一种如图1、图3所示
1、当GSN向CG1发送话单后,未收到响应前,通讯中断,则GSN将此话单转而发送给CG2,消息类型为“可能重复的话单”,此时CG2将此话单保存,不立即发送给BS;2、当CG1通讯恢复正常后,GSN向CG1发送“测试空帧”,询问CG1在通讯中断前是否已经收到话单,CG1回复“已收到”;3、GSN向CG2发送“删除话单消息”,通知CG2将此话单删除。
CG单重重定向技术流程简单,实现也简单。但也存在这样的问题当话单发送给CG1但未得到响应前,如果GSN和CG1间通讯中断,此时必须将此未得到响应的话单发给CG2;由于CG1有可能收到此话单,当CG1和CG2将话单汇总到BS,有可能导致重复话单问题。
所以,在CG的重定向功能中,必须有避免重复话单的机制。为实现此机制,协议规定由GSN控制发往多个CG的话单,是丢弃还是汇总给BS。因此GSN必须记录每个已经发送给CG但未收到响应的话单状态,以及发送历史记录。
当在特殊情况下,话单发送给CG1后通讯中断,则此话单发送给CG2,但是未得到响应前和CG2的通讯又中断,如此重复,当连续发生多个CG中断时,GSN保存话单发送历史记录将耗费大量内存资源,当话单数量增多时,处理效率很低,而且实现方法复杂。
为了实现本发明的目的,本发明采取的技术方案是,移动通讯系统中计费网关多重重定向实现装置,其特点是,包括一个通用分组无线业务支持节点(GSN),该通用分组无线业务支持节点用于对用户移动终端的使用情况进行统计,并将产生原始的话单发送给计费网关;n个计费网关(CG),每个计费网关用于收集通用分组无线业务支持节点产生的原始话单,并对该原始话单进行合并和过滤;在正常情况下,通用分组无线业务支持节点将所有话单默认发往第一个计费网关;当通用分组无线业务支持节点与第一个计费网关的联系中断后,通用分组无线业务支持节点将所有话单默认发往第二个计费网关;如果通用分组无线业务支持节点与第二个计费网关的联系又中断,通用分组无线业务支持节点则将又会重定向到第三个计费网关,依次类推,直至重定向到一个通讯正常的计费网关;以及,一个计费系统(BS),该计费系统用于收集计费网关发来的话单,并对计费网关发来的话单进行处理,形成最终的用户话单。
上述移动通讯系统中计费网关多重重定向实现装置,其中,所述的计费网关的多少是根据通用分组无线业务支持节点的容量设置。
上述移动通讯系统中计费网关多重重定向实现装置,其中,所述的计费网关的设置为三个及其以上。
移动通讯系统中计费网关多重重定向实现方法,其特点是,包括以下步骤a、在正常情况下,通用分组无线业务支持节点向计费网关发送话单,并得到计费网关的响应后,删除话单;b、当通用分组无线业务支持节点向第一个计费网关发送话单后,未收到响应前,通讯中断,则通用分组无线业务支持节点立即将此话单转发送给第二个计费网关,消息类型为“可能重复的话单”,此时第二个计费网关将此话单保存,不立即发送给计费系统;c、如果在通用分组无线业务支持节点发送“可能重复的话单”给第二个计费网关后,和第二个计费网关的通讯又中断,此时通用分组无线业务支持节点将此话单转而发送给第三个计费网关,但发送完毕后和第三个计费网关的通讯又中断;如此重复,直到重定向给通信正常的第n个计费网关;d、通用分组无线业务支持节点收到第n个计费网关发出的“收到该话单的发送响应”后,将该话单删除,此时,话单保留在第n个计费网关中;e、当第1个计费网关通讯恢复正常后,通用分组无线业务支持节点向第1个计费网关发送“测试空帧”,询问计费网关在通讯中断前是否已经收到话单;f、如果第1个计费网关回复“已收到”信息,通用分组无线业务支持节点向第n个计费网关发送“删除话单”消息,通知第n个计费网关将此话单删除;
g、如果第1个计费网关回复“未收到”信息,通用分组无线业务支持节点向第n个计费网关发送“释放话单”消息,通知第n个计费网关将此话单释放给计费系统;h、对于第2个到第n-1个计费网关,当它们通讯恢复正常后,不管它们是否收到话单,通用分组无线业务支持节点都向它们发送“删除话单”消息;i、计费系统对各计费网关发来的话单进行处理,形成最终的用户话单。
由于本发明采用了以上的技术方案,在计费网关的多重重定向的处理中,对于发送给中间计费网关的话单(未经确认的话单),一律作删除处理,即当CG2~CG(n-1)通讯正常后,对于重定向的话单,GSN一律向CG发送“删除此话单”的消息。如此处理既能遵循协议,避免BS收到重复话单,又不需记录整个CG重定向的复杂过程,实现方法简单、高效,极大的节约系统资源。
图1是已有技术重定向系统示意图。
图2是已有技术重定向处理流程简图(CG1故障前未收到话单)。
图3是图2的CG1故障前已收到话单的处理流程简图。
图4是本发明多重重定向的系统示意图。
图5是本发明的信号处理流程简图。
在正常情况下,通用分组无线业务支持节点将所有话单默认发往第一个计费网关CG1;当通用分组无线业务支持节点与第一个计费网关的联系中断后,通用分组无线业务支持节点将所有话单默认发往第二个计费网关CG2,即重定向到CG2;如果在话单发送过程中,通用分组无线业务支持节点与第二个计费网关CG2的联系又中断,通用分组无线业务支持节点则将又会重定向到第三个计费网关CG3(此时,通用分组无线业务支持节点和CG1、CG2的通讯都中断,且尚未恢复),依次类推,直至重定向到一个通讯正常的计费网关CGn(CGn和通用分组无线业务支持节点的通讯始终都正常)。
请见图5,本发明移动通讯系统中无线业务的计费网关多重重定向实现方法,可以通过以下步骤来实现a、在正常情况下,通用分组无线业务支持节点GSN向计费网关CG1发送话单,并得到计费网关的响应后,删除话单;b、当通用分组无线业务支持节点GSN向第一个计费网关CG1发送话单后,未收到响应前,通讯中断,则通用分组无线业务支持节点GSN立即将此话单转发送给第二个计费网关CG2(即重定向到CG2),消息类型为“可能重复的话单”,此时第二个计费网关CG2将此话单保存,不立即发送给计费系统(由于CG2收到的消息类型为“可能重复的话单”,说明此话单可能已经通过其他CG发送给BS了,但是此时GSN和CG2都不能判断,只能等到CG1通讯正常后,由GSN向CG1确认,然后通知CG2如何处理此话单,也即是删除话单还是将此话单发送给BS);c、如果在通用分组无线业务支持节点GSN发送“可能重复的话单”给第二个计费网关CG2后,和第二个计费网关CG2的通讯又中断,此时通用分组无线业务GSN支持节点将此话单转而发送给第三个计费网关CG3,但发送完毕后和第三个计费网关的通讯又中断;如此重复,直到重定向给通信正常的第n个计费网关CGn;d、通用分组无线业务支持节点收到第n个计费网关CGn发出的“收到该话单的发送响应”后,将该话单删除,此时,话单保留在第n个计费网关CGn中;e、当第1个计费网关通讯恢复正常后,通用分组无线业务支持节点向第1个计费网关发送“测试空帧”,询问该计费网关在通讯中断前是否已经收到话单;
f、如果第1个计费网关回复“已收到”信息,通用分组无线业务支持节点向第n个计费网关发送“删除话单消息”,通知第n个计费网关将此话单删除;g、如果第1个计费网关回复“未收到”信息,通用分组无线业务支持节点向第n个计费网关发送“释放话单”消息,通知第n个计费网关将此话单释放给计费系统;h、对于第2个到第n-1个计费网关,当它们通讯恢复正常后,不管它们是否收到话单,通用分组无线业务支持节点都向它们发送“删除话单”消息;i、计费系统对各计费网关发来的话单进行处理,形成最终的用户话单。
按照本发明的方法,不论CG2~CG(n-1)有没有收到话单,都向这些CG发送“删除话单消息”,从而GSN不用保存多重重定向的历史记录,也不用判断这些CG是否收到话单,只需记录CG1和CGn的状态,从而将多重重定向复杂的处理流程简化为单重重定向的简单流程。
权利要求
1.移动通讯系统中计费网关多重重定向实现装置,其特征在于,包括一个通用分组无线业务支持节点,该通用分组无线业务支持节点用于对用户移动终端的使用情况进行统计,并将产生原始的话单发送给计费网关;n个计费网关,每个计费网关用于收集通用分组无线业务支持节点产生的原始话单,并对该原始话单进行合并和过滤;在正常情况下,通用分组无线业务支持节点将所有话单默认发往第一个计费网关;当通用分组无线业务支持节点与第一个计费网关的联系中断后,通用分组无线业务支持节点将所有话单默认发往第二个计费网关;如果通用分组无线业务支持节点与第二个计费网关的联系又中断,通用分组无线业务支持节点则将又会重定向到第三个计费网关,依次类推,直至重定向到一个通讯正常的计费网关;以及,一个计费系统,该计费系统用于收集计费网关发来的话单,并对计费网关发来的话单进行处理,形成最终的用户话单。
2.根据权利要求1所述的移动通讯系统中计费网关多重重定向实现装置,其特征在于,所述的计费网关的多少是根据通用分组无线业务支持节点的容量设置。
3.根据权利要求1或2所述的移动通讯系统中计费网关多重重定向实现装置,其特征在于,所述的计费网关的设置为三个及其以上。
4.移动通讯系统中计费网关多重重定向实现方法,其特征在于,包括以下步骤a、在正常情况下,通用分组无线业务支持节点向计费网关发送话单,并得到计费网关的响应后,删除话单;b、当通用分组无线业务支持节点向第一个计费网关发送话单后,未收到响应前,通讯中断,则通用分组无线业务支持节点立即将此话单转发送给第二个计费网关,消息类型为“可能重复的话单”,此时第二个计费网关将此话单保存,不立即发送给计费系统;c、如果在通用分组无线业务支持节点发送“可能重复的话单”给第二个计费网关后,和第二个计费网关的通讯又中断,此时通用分组无线业务支持节点将此话单转而发送给第三个计费网关,但发送完毕后和第三个计费网关的通讯又中断;如此重复,直到重定向给通信正常的第n个计费网关;d、通用分组无线业务支持节点收到第n个计费网关发出的“收到该话单的发送响应”后,将该话单删除,此时,话单保留在第n个计费网关中;e、当第1个计费网关通讯恢复正常后,通用分组无线业务支持节点向第1个计费网关发送“测试空帧”,询问计费网关在通讯中断前是否已经收到话单;f、如果第1个计费网关回复“已收到”信息,通用分组无线业务支持节点向第n个计费网关发送“删除话单”消息,通知第n个计费网关将此话单删除;g、如果第1个计费网关回复“未收到”信息,通用分组无线业务支持节点向第n个计费网关发送“释放话单”消息,通知第n个计费网关将此话单释放给计费系统;h、对于第2个到第n-1个计费网关,当它们通讯恢复正常后,不管它们是否收到话单,通用分组无线业务支持节点都向它们发送“删除话单”消息;i、计费系统对各计费网关发来的话单进行处理,形成最终的用户话单。
全文摘要
本发明移动通讯系统中计费网关多重重定向实现方法及其装置,其特点是,包括一个通用分组无线业务支持节点(GSN),n个计费网关(CG)以及一个计费系统(BS)。在正常情况下,GSN将所有话单默认发往CG1;当GSN与CG1的联系中断后,GSN将所有话单默认发往CG2;如GSN与CG2的联系又中断,GSN则将又会重定向到CG3,依次类推,直至重定向到一个通讯正常的计费网关CGn。然后再进行计费处理。实现简单,节约系统资源,效率高。
文档编号H04W4/24GK1395384SQ01113269
公开日2003年2月5日 申请日期2001年7月6日 优先权日2001年7月6日
发明者周耀辉 申请人:华为技术有限公司
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1